Today we welcome our very first Ninja to the show. Corbin Mackin served with The Rifles, and fought with them in Afghanistan. Following the death of his brother Travis - A Royal Marine - Corbin's life began to unravel. Then, after leaving the army, he found a new challenge in an unlikely pace - professional obstacle course racing. This is a fascinating episode with a truly inspiring bloke.
